Sandisk is Giving up Some Margin for a Bigger Reward

Dow Jones
08/07

Sandisk shareholders didn't love the flash-memory company's guidance. But at least one element of their disquiet -- its apparently peaking margins -- shouldn't be a worry.

Sandisk shares were down 3.7% at $1,306 on Thursday after the company's earnings beat expectations, but its forecast came in below Wall Street's expectations.

One of the factors that could be causing concern is that Sandisk projected its gross margin for the September quarter would be 83-85%, which at the midpoint would be down from 84.6% in the June quarter. That comes as the company locks in its new business model (NBM) agreements, which lock in customers at prices over the longer term.

Sandisk's move is in line with those of peers such as Micron Technology, and the same logic applies. While the company might be giving up a certain amount of profit now, it should be locking in bigger earnings over the longer term, potentially convincing the market it deserves a higher price-to-earnings multiple.

Sandisk, along with other memory companies, normally trades at a notably low forward price-to-earnings ratio because the memory-chip industry goes through cycles of boom and bust. Currently, it trades at a forward P/E multiple of just 6.04 times, according to FactSet.

However, Raymond James analyst Melissa Fairbanks argues that Sandisk deserves at least a 8.0 times multiple on her forecasts for its fiscal 2028 earnings. She raised her target price on the stock to $2,000 from $1,470 in a research note Thursday, reiterating an Outperform rating.

"Sandisk continues to benefit from accelerating AI-driven datacenter demand, while the rapid adoption of its new business model (NBMs) is materially improving earnings visibility, pricing discipline, and margin durability," wrote Fairbanks. "We suspect the economics of NBM remain robust, with floor pricing supporting gross margins of 80%."
